IMToken 是知名的数字钱包,Keystore 与之相关,数字资产安全至关重要,imToken 的冷钱包下载为保障资产安全提供途径,冷钱包可离线存储私钥等信息,降低被盗风险,深入了解它们,能让用户更好地管理数字资产,确保其安全性,在数字资产领域,这些要素是保障资产安全的关键所在。imtoken keystore
在当今数字化时代,加密货币和区块链技术的发展如火如荼,imToken 作为一款知名的数字钱包应用,在加密货币领域占据着重要地位,而 Keystore 则是与数字资产安全密切相关的重要概念,本文将深入探讨 imToken 以及 Keystore 的相关知识,包括它们的定义、功能、原理以及在数字资产安全管理中的重要性。
imToken 概述
(一)imToken 简介
imToken 是一款多链数字钱包,支持以太坊、比特币、EOS 等多种主流区块链资产的存储、转账、交易等操作,它以简洁易用的界面和强大的功能受到了广大加密货币用户的喜爱,imToken 不仅提供了基本的钱包功能,还集成了去中心化应用(DApp)浏览器,用户可以在钱包内直接访问各种区块链应用,实现一站式的数字资产体验。
(二)imToken 的功能特点
- 多链支持:能够管理多种不同区块链的资产,方便用户集中管理自己的数字财富。
- 安全存储:采用了先进的加密技术和安全机制,保障用户资产的安全。
- 便捷操作:简单直观的界面设计,即使是新手用户也能快速上手进行转账、交易等操作。
- DApp 生态:集成了丰富的 DApp 应用,用户可以在钱包内参与各种去中心化金融(DeFi)、游戏、社交等应用,拓展了数字资产的使用场景。
Keystore 详解
(一)Keystore 的定义
Keystore 是一种加密文件,它包含了用户的私钥信息,但并不是以明文形式存储,Keystore 文件是通过对私钥进行加密处理后生成的,其目的是为了在一定程度上保护私钥的安全,防止私钥被轻易窃取。
(二)Keystore 的生成原理
- 加密算法:通常使用诸如 PBKDF2(Password - Based Key Derivation Function 2)等密码基密钥派生函数,用户设置的密码会与一个随机生成的盐(salt)一起作为输入,经过多次迭代计算,生成一个加密密钥。
- 私钥加密:使用生成的加密密钥对私钥进行加密,得到密文,会记录加密算法、迭代次数、盐等相关参数,这些信息与密文一起组成了 Keystore 文件。
(三)Keystore 的用途
- 私钥保护:在用户需要使用私钥进行签名交易等操作时,通过输入正确的密码,利用 Keystore 文件中的信息可以解密出私钥,这样,即使 Keystore 文件被他人获取,如果没有正确的密码,也无法得到私钥,从而保护了用户的资产安全。
- 跨平台使用:Keystore 文件可以在不同的支持该格式的钱包应用中使用,只要用户记住密码,就可以在相应的平台上恢复对数字资产的控制。
imToken 与 Keystore 的关系
(一)imToken 中的 Keystore
在 imToken 中,当用户创建钱包时,会生成相应的 Keystore 文件,用户可以选择备份 Keystore 文件,以便在需要时(如更换设备、恢复钱包等)使用,imToken 对 Keystore 文件的管理遵循一定的安全规范,确保用户在使用过程中的资产安全。
(二)imToken 如何使用 Keystore
- 创建钱包:用户在 imToken 中创建钱包时,系统会提示用户设置密码,并生成 Keystore 文件,这个文件会被加密存储在用户的设备中(通常是加密的存储区域)。
- 交易签名:当用户进行转账、交易等需要签名的操作时,imToken 会要求用户输入密码,imToken 会使用用户输入的密码,结合 Keystore 文件中的信息,解密出私钥,并用私钥对交易进行签名,完成交易操作。
- 钱包恢复:如果用户更换设备或需要恢复钱包,只需在新设备上安装 imToken,选择通过 Keystore 文件恢复钱包,并输入正确的密码,imToken 就会根据 Keystore 文件中的信息重建钱包,用户可以重新获得对数字资产的访问权限。
Keystore 的安全注意事项
(一)密码安全
- 设置强密码:密码应包含大小写字母、数字和特殊字符,长度足够长(建议至少 12 位以上),避免使用简单易猜的密码,如生日、电话号码等。
- 定期更换密码:虽然 Keystore 文件本身有一定的安全性,但定期更换密码可以进一步降低密码被破解的风险。
- 不泄露密码:绝对不能将钱包密码告诉任何人,包括 imToken 官方客服(imToken 官方不会以任何理由索要用户密码)。
(二)Keystore 文件备份
- 多副本备份:将 Keystore 文件备份到多个安全的地方,如离线存储设备(U盘、移动硬盘等)、加密的云存储(但要注意云存储的安全性)。
- 离线备份:为了防止网络攻击导致备份文件泄露,建议进行离线备份,将 Keystore 文件打印出来(但要注意保护打印内容的安全),或者存储在未联网的设备中。
(三)防范钓鱼与恶意软件
- 官方渠道下载:确保从 imToken 官方网站或正规的应用商店下载 imToken 应用,避免下载到恶意篡改的版本。
- 警惕钓鱼网站:在输入密码或恢复钱包等操作时,要仔细核对网址,防止进入钓鱼网站,被窃取 Keystore 文件和密码。
- 安装安全软件:在设备上安装可靠的杀毒软件和防火墙,防范恶意软件窃取 Keystore 文件等敏感信息。
案例分析
(一)因密码泄露导致资产损失案例
某用户在 imToken 中创建钱包后,设置了一个简单的密码(如“123456”),后来,该用户的设备感染了恶意软件,恶意软件通过键盘记录等方式获取了用户的密码,恶意软件获取了用户的 Keystore 文件(可能是通过窃取用户的备份文件或直接从设备存储中获取),并使用密码解密出私钥,将用户钱包中的加密货币全部转走,导致用户遭受了重大资产损失。
(二)成功利用 Keystore 恢复钱包案例
另一位用户在更换手机时,提前备份了 imToken 的 Keystore 文件到 U 盘,当在新手机上安装 imToken 后,通过选择 Keystore 文件恢复钱包,并输入正确的密码,顺利恢复了钱包,重新获得了对数字资产的访问权限,避免了因设备更换而导致资产丢失的风险。
未来发展趋势
(一)Keystore 技术的改进
随着密码学技术的不断发展,Keystore 可能会采用更先进的加密算法和密钥派生函数,提高加密强度和安全性,可能会引入更高效的抗量子计算攻击的加密算法,以应对未来可能出现的量子计算威胁。
(二)imToken 与 Keystore 的融合创新
imToken 可能会进一步优化对 Keystore 的管理和使用体验,提供更便捷的 Keystore 备份和恢复方式,或者与硬件钱包等更安全的存储设备进行更深度的集成,利用硬件钱包的安全特性来增强 Keystore 的安全性,imToken 也可能会探索基于 Keystore 的更多应用场景,如与身份认证、数据加密等领域的结合,拓展数字资产安全管理的边界。
imToken 作为一款重要的数字钱包应用,与 Keystore 紧密相连,Keystore 在保护用户私钥、保障数字资产安全方面发挥着关键作用,用户在使用 imToken 时,必须充分了解 Keystore 的原理、用途和安全注意事项,采取有效的安全措施,如设置强密码、妥善备份 Keystore 文件、防范钓鱼和恶意软件等,才能确保自己的数字资产安全,随着技术的不断发展,imToken 和 Keystore 也将不断演进,为用户提供更安全、更便捷的数字资产服务,在加密货币和区块链技术的浪潮中,保障数字资产安全始终是用户和行业发展的重中之重,而深入理解 imToken 与 Keystore 则是迈向安全数字资产生活的重要一步。
imtoken keystore怎么用


